Stones and Rocks

Goliath had four brothers
that is the reason why,
David picked up five smooth stones
the giant to defy.

He dared to stand and face him
as armies shook with fear.
One stone knocked the giant down
so David could draw near.

He picked up that giant's sword
to swiftly take his head,
one blow to God's enemy
Goliath lay there dead. 

But David did not cast off
the four remaining stones,
in case the brothers ever
required a gravestone.

Don't loose sight in the battle
think one fight and it is done
Depend upon our Brother,
Who's ev'ry battle won.

scripture;
He has placed my feet upon a Rock, 
high above my enemies,

c.d.m.5/19/17
